Using only energy from waste straw and the power of the planet, an engineering prototype Flying Spur Hybrid has completed a dramatic test as part of the car’s sign off and Bentley’s development of renewable fuels.
The Azure Purple Flying Spur Hybrid covered the 733 km (455 miles) required to drive across Iceland in a single stint and entirely on renewable power, through a combination of 100 per cent second generation biofuel and geothermally-sourced electricity available from the Icelandic power grid.
The journey is validation both of the grand touring range of Bentley’s new Hybrid – the second to be launched following the Bentayga Hybrid – and of Bentley’s research into biofuels that can be used without engine modification. The fuel used conforms to the same EN228 standard as ordinary pump gasoline, yet is created entirely from waste biomass (e.g. straw) at no cost to food production or the natural ecosystem. The combination of this fuel and the Flying Spur Hybrid’s intelligent electrified powertrain meant an overall reduction of 45 per cent in CO2 emissions on a well-to-wheels basis over the course of the adventure. Renewably Energised
Renewable fuel defines a significant step towards reducing Bentley’s environmental impact and supporting the company’s sustainability targets. This Icelandic journey is the result of further development since the debut of renewable fuel for Bentley in the Continental GT3 race car at the Pikes Peak International Hill Climb in June.
The 100 per cent renewable, second generation biofuel used is a wonder of modern chemistry, and was developed by Coryton, who is supporting Bentley in renewable fuel research. The production process sees waste biomass (e.g. straw) broken down using fermentation, leading to the creation of ethanol. Dehydration of the ethanol converts it to ethylene, which can then be transformed into gasoline through the process of oligomerisation – chaining short hydrocarbon molecules together to produce longer, more energy-dense ones.
The electricity used by the car’s hybrid system during the journey was sourced from Iceland’s 100 per cent renewable grid. Iceland is a global leader in renewable energy production; 75 per cent of the country’s electrical energy is produced via Hydroelectric and 25 per cent from geothermal power. During its time in Iceland, the Flying Spur Hybrid was charged with electricity from the Svartsengi geothermal power plant.
The Driving Force Behind The Flying Spur Hybrid
The latest addition to Bentley’s new hybrid range demonstrates that hybridisation does not compromise luxury or performance. With an unperceivable blend between the internal combustion engine and electric motor, refined serenity is on offer regardless of driving mode or style.
The new powertrain combines a 2.9-litre V6 petrol engine with an advanced electric motor, delivering a total of 536 bhp (544 PS) and 750 Nm (553 lb.ft) of torque – an additional 95 bhp in comparison to the Bentayga Hybrid. The new Flying Spur becomes the most efficient Bentley ever having the capability to cover 700 km when fully fuelled.
With high power reserves, superior torque and quick throttle response, the latest hybrid model gives little away to the Flying Spur V8 in acceleration, passing 60 mph from a standstill in 4.1 seconds (0-100 km/h in 4.3 secs). The new powertrain achieves a significant reduction in fuel consumption, whilst still providing the authentic Bentley character of effortless, refined performance.

EXTERIOR
Clients are free to select any of the marque’s 44,000 ‘ready-to-wear’ colours or create their own entirely unique Bespoke hue. However, the overwhelming majority of women and men who requested this darker expression of Ghost have selected the signature Black. To create what is the motor car industry’s darkest black, 100lbs (45kg) of paint is atomised and applied to an electrostatically charged body in white before being oven dried. The motor car then receives two layers of clear coat before being hand-polished by a team of four craftsman to produce the marque’s signature high-gloss piano finish.
At between three and five hours in duration, this operation is entirely unknown in mass production, creating an intensity simply unattainable elsewhere in the automotive industry. It is this depth of darkness that serves as the perfect canvas for clients to add a high-contrast, hand-painted Coachline, which has done much to create the Black Badge ‘black and neon’ aesthetic that has come to characterise this vivid family of Rolls-Royce motor cars.
To match this dramatic coachwork, the marque’s Bespoke Collective of designers, engineers and craftspeople collaborated to create an entirely customisable process that allows Rolls-Royce hallmarks such as the high-polished Spirit of Ecstasy and Pantheon Grille to be subverted. Instead of simply painting these components, a specific chrome electrolyte is introduced to the traditional chrome plating process that is co-deposited on the stainless-steel substrate, darkening the finish. Its final thickness is just one micrometre – around one hundredth of the width of a human hair. Each of these components is precision-polished by hand to achieve a mirror-black chrome finish before it is fitted to the motor car.
The exterior treatment resolves with a Bespoke 21-inch composite wheelset. Designed in the Black Badge house style and reserved for Black Badge Ghost, the barrel of each wheel is made up of 22 layers of carbon fibre laid on three axes, then folded back on themselves at the outer edges of the rim, forming a total of 44 layers of carbon fibre for greater strength. A 3D-forged aluminium hub is bonded to the rim using aerospace-grade titanium fasteners and finished with the marque’s hallmark Floating Hubcap, ensuring the Double R monogram remains upright at all times. To celebrate the material substance and remarkable surface effect, a lightly tinted lacquer is applied to protect the finish but still allow clients to observe the technical complexity of the wheels unique carbon fibre construction.
INTERIOR
Advanced luxury materials have been meticulously created and crafted for a unique ambience in the interior suite. While recalling the dramatic mechanical intent of Black Badge Ghost, the materials are true to Ghost’s Post Opulent design philosophy – one defined by authenticity and material substance rather than overt statement. In this spirit, a complex but subtle weave that incorporates a deep diamond pattern rendered in carbon and metallic fibres has been created by the marque’s craftspeople.
Multiple wood layers are pressed onto the interior component substrates, using black Bolivar veneer for the uppermost base layer. This forms a dark foundation for the Technical Fibre layers that follow. Leaves woven from resin-coated carbon and contrasting metal-coated thread laid in a diamond pattern are applied by hand to the components in perfect alignment, creating a three-dimensional effect. To secure this extraordinary veneer, each component is cured for one hour under pressure at 100°C. This is then sand-blasted to create a keyed surface for six layers of lacquer, which is hand-sanded and polished before being incorporated into the motor car.
If specified in the client’s commission, the Technical Fibre ‘Waterfall’ section of the individual rear seats receives the Black Badge family motif: the mathematical symbol that represents potential infinity known as a Lemniscate. Rendered in aerospace-grade aluminium on the lid of Black Badge Ghost’s Champagne cooler, it is applied between the third and fourth layer of a total of six layers of subtly tinted lacquer, creating the illusion that the symbol is floating above the Technical Fibre veneer.
Aesthetes from the marque’s design team elected to further enhance the noir ambience of Black Badge Ghost by subduing the brightwork. Air vent surrounds on the dashboard and in the rear cabin are darkened using physical vapour deposition, one of the few methods of colouring metal that ensures parts will not discolour or tarnish over time or through repeated use. The Post Opulent principles of simplicity have also been applied to dramatic effect in the Black Badge Ghost timepiece design: only the tips of the hands and the twelve, three, six and nine o’clock markers are picked out, in a subdued chrome finish, creating a remarkably minimal clock. Additional timepieces are available within Black Badge Ghost to suit the client’s aesthetic preference.
The timepiece is flanked by a world-first Bespoke innovation that debuted with Ghost: the Illuminated Fascia, which displays an ethereal glowing Lemniscate, surrounded by more than 850 stars. Located on the passenger side of the dashboard, the constellation and motif are completely invisible when the interior lights are not in operation. As in Ghost, the Lemniscate motif is illuminated via 152 LEDs mounted above and beneath the fascia, each meticulously colour-matched to the cabin’s clock and instrument dial lighting. To ensure the Lemniscate is lit evenly, a 2mm-thick light guide is used, featuring more than 90,000 laser-etched dots across the surface. This not only disperses the light evenly but creates a twinkling effect as the eye moves across the fascia, echoing the subtle sparkle of the Shooting Star Starlight Headliner.
ENGINEERING
Black Badge is not just an aesthetic – it is an experience. The clients who requested this motor car demanded that the Bespoke treatment of Black Badge Ghost extend from the design atelier into the marque’s engineering department. In doing so, the Bespoke Collective of designers, engineers and craftspeople collaborated to create a vivid driving personality that matched Black Badge Ghost’s visual intent without compromising the marque’s effortless ride proclivities and exhaustive acoustic tuning.
Key to its potent character is the Architecture of Luxury, Rolls-Royce’s proprietary all-aluminium spaceframe architecture that debuted with Phantom. This sub-structure not only delivers extraordinary body stiffness, but its flexibility and scalability allowed Ghost to be equipped with all-wheel drive, four-wheel steering and the award-winning Planar Suspension system. For Black Badge, these peerless engineering qualities have been comprehensively re-engineered, including the fitting of more voluminous air springs to alleviate body roll under more assertive cornering.
The capacity of the Rolls-Royce twin-turbocharged 6.75-litre V12 engine was deemed sufficient. However, the flexibility of this celebrated power plant has been exploited to generate an extra 29PS, creating a total output of 600PS. The sense of a single infinite gear has also been dramatised with the addition of a further 50NM of torque, for a total of 900NM. The powertrain has also received Bespoke transmission and throttle treatments to further enhance the engine’s increased power reserves. The ZF eight-speed gear box and both front- and rear-steered axles work collaboratively to adjust the levels of feedback to the driver, depending on throttle and steering inputs.
As with all products in the marque’s Black Badge portfolio, the ‘Low’ button situated on the gear selection stalk unlocks Black Badge Ghost’s full suite of technologies. This is asserted by the amplification of the motor car’s engine through an entirely new exhaust system, subtly announcing its potency. All 900NM of torque is available from just 1700rpm and, once underway in Low Mode, gearshift speeds are increased by 50% when the throttle is depressed to 90%, delivering Black Badge Ghost’s abundant power reserves with dramatic immediacy.
To bolster confidence when exploiting Black Badge Ghost, the braking bite point has been raised and pedal travel decreased. Non-Black Badge Ghost is provisioned with a robust braking hardware package that was deemed more than ample under extreme conditions, even accounting for the Black Badge alter ego’s increased power output. However, a new suite of bold high-temperature brake calliper paint colours has been developed in preparation for forthcoming Black Badge Ghost commissions.

Advanced speaker technology builds on the fundamental refinement provided by the MLA-Flex body architecture to deliver serene cabin calmness – ensuring passengers enjoy a first-class experience. It uses the 1,600W Meridian Signature Sound System to create one of the quietest vehicle interiors on the road, with additional 20W speakers in the four main headrests for the most immersive sound experience.
The third-generation Active Noise Cancellation8 system monitors wheel vibrations, tyre noise and engine sounds transmitted into the cabin and generates a cancelling signal, which is played through the system’s 35 speakers. These include a pair of 60mm diameter speakers in the headrests for each of the four main cabin occupants, which create personal quiet zones similar to the effect when using high-end headphones.
The New Range Rover brings new levels of wellbeing to the luxury SUV sector and Cabin Air Purification Pro3 is the culmination of this pioneering technology. It combines dual-nanoeTM X technology for allergen reduction and pathogen removal, to help significantly reduce odours and viruses, while CO2 Management and PM2.5 Cabin Air Filtration enhance air quality. Advanced nanoeTM X technology is scientifically proven to significantly reduce viruses and bacteria including SARS-CoV-2 viruses3. The innovative technology is active in the air, so particles don’t have to pass through a filter to be trapped and neutralised. A second nanoeTM X device in Row 2 optimises its effectiveness for all occupants.

Serene capability and composure
The flagship of the Land Rover family represents the pinnacle of refined capability thanks to advanced hardware and software systems working in complete harmony, enabled by the new MLA-Flex body architecture. This unrivalled breadth of dynamic capability is governed by Land Rover’s Integrated Chassis Control – a single control system for a suite of advanced technologies that tailor the vehicle dynamics to suit every mile of every journey, to pre-emptively and reactively fine-tune the driving characteristics.
Rory O’Murchu, Vehicle Line Director, Jaguar Land Rover, said:“The New Range Rover combines advanced hardware with a pioneering toolkit of digital technologies and software, all enabled by our advanced electrical architecture – moving Range Rover from a mechanical world to a mechatronic ecosystem that delivers an intuitive drive. Our new Integrated Chassis Control system is a prime example of this philosophy and co-ordinates a suite of predictive and reactive technologies, that make this the most comfortable and agile Range Rover ever produced.”
Every New Range Rover features All-Wheel Steering5 for an effortless drive with heightened high-speed stability and improved manoeuvrability at low speeds, ensuring it is equally at home on the open road and negotiating tight urban streets.
The electrically operated rear axle provides up to seven degrees of steering angle and, at low speeds, turns out-of-phase of the front wheels, giving the New Range Rover a turning circle of less than 11m4 – the smallest of any Land Rover. At higher speeds the rear axle turns in phase with the front wheels for enhanced stability and comfort.
The New Range Rover is also the first Land Rover to feature Dynamic Response Pro. The powerful new active 48-volt electronic roll control system is faster-acting and more efficient than a hydraulic set-up, with a torque capacity of up to 1,400Nm fed into the anti-roll bars to keep body movements under control.
Fully independent air suspension isolates the cabin from surface imperfections more effectively than ever, for serene composure at all times. It combines industry-leading air springs volumes with twin-valve dampers – all managed by in-house-developed Adaptive Dynamics control software.
The intelligent All-Wheel Drive (iAWD) transmission is controlled by Land Rover’s Intelligent Driveline Dynamics (IDD) system, which monitors grip levels and driver inputs 100 times a second to predictively distribute torque between the front and rear axles, and across the rear axle, for optimum traction on and off-road.
Every Range Rover also features an Active Locking Rear Differential. This optimises traction from the rear axle during high-speed cornering, on slippery surfaces and during off-road wheel articulation, delivering enhanced capability and driver confidence.
All of this technology feeds into Land Rover’s award-winning Terrain Response 2 system, which harnesses the various chassis systems to automatically provide the perfect settings for the surroundings, from a choice of six driving modes, to minimise driver workload across all terrains. Alternatively, the driver can select the most appropriate setting manually or, use Configurable Terrain Response to create a bespoke chassis set-up.
Electrified efficiency
The New Range Rover maintains its compelling combination of effortless performance and peerless refinement with a comprehensive line-up of advanced six- and eight-cylinder powertrains. Spearheading Land Rover’s Reimagine strategy, a pure-electric model will join the family in 2024, bringing full-time zero tailpipe emissions driving to the Range Rover for the first time.
The New Range Rover provides electrified performance with a choice of new Extended Range Plug-in Hybrid Electric Vehicle (PHEV) powertrains5, the P440e and P510e, and the latest mild-hybrid (MHEV) P400 Ingenium petrol and D300 and D350 diesel engines. A powerful new petrol flagship – the P530 Twin Turbo V8 – delivers increased refinement and performance and is 17 per cent more efficient than the previous Range Rover V8.
The new Extended-Range PHEVs5 combine the inherent refinement of Land Rover’s in-line six-cylinder Ingenium petrol engine with a 38.2kWh lithium-ion battery – with usable capacity of 31.8kWh – and a 105kW electric motor integrated with the transmission. Together, the powertrain provides up to 100km (62 miles) of near-silent pure-electric driving. With instantaneous electric torque the new P510e accelerates from 0-60mph in 5.3s (0-100km/h in 5.6s).
The state-of-the-art PHEVs can reach up to 140km/h (87mph) allowing customers to enjoy the New Range Rover as an EV-only model for most journeys in town and country, with overall CO2 emissions lower than 30g/km1Typical Range Rover customers will be able to complete up to 75 per cent of trips using electric power only7 if they begin each journey with a full charge. The clever packaging of the battery, beneath the vehicle and within the wheelbase, ensures both luggage space and all-terrain capability are uncompromised.
The use of advanced eHorizon navigation data also allows the hybrid system to optimise energy usage across a journey, to provide a peaceful arrival at a destination on electric power, while also optimising EV usage for travel in low emissions zones.
The six-cylinder petrol and diesel engines feature the latest 48-volt MHEV technology which harvests energy usually lost under deceleration and braking to boost fuel efficiency. The system’s clever belt-integrated starter motor ensures more responsive and refined operation of the stop-start system and provides extra assistance to the engine when accelerating.
